  • The Ledge #462: New Releases (Pt. 2)

    Last week’s new release show was all about submitted tracks. This week’s part two of the series compiles all of the other new records that have recently been released (or will be soon). The show is marked by the return of quite a few veteran artists, including Matthew Sweet, Liz Phair, Juliana Hatfield, and many others. There’s also quite a few long-awaited followup records by bands such as Kiwi Jr., Shame, and Baby Shakes. Plus a lot of other odds and ends.

  • The Ledge #431: New Releases, Pt. 2

    As I said last week, there have been so many great releases in the last few weeks that this month’s new release episode was forced to expand to two episodes. Quality-wise, there’s no difference between the two episodes. In fact, it could be argued that this episode is more varoius than last week’s as it flows in and out of punk, post-punk, power pop, jangle-pop, experimental pop, psych, and even a nod to folk thanks to some of the last recordings by legendary rockers The Pretty Things.
